ATTR 400 - Emergency Medical Technician Training

(4 credits)
Prerequisite: Restricted to Athletic Training majors or consent of instructor
The primary focus of this course is to prepare the students to successfully pass the Massachusetts EMT Practical Skills Exam and The National Registry of EMT’s written cognitive exam. The successful candidate will be taught how to effectively care for sick, injured and critically ill/injured patients in accordance with the Massachusetts State Treatment Protocols. Additional components of the class include eight hours of required ambulance observation ride-a-longs or eight hours of observation time in the emergency room of a local hospital emergency department. An alternative to an ambulance red-along would be to spend eight hours with the BSU Police Department as they respond to EMS calls for assistance. Offered fall and spring semesters.
